P.S. I hear that daylight savings time is next week. Will this affect the ship?

::yes:: Yes it will ::yes:: - but you will be changing your clock all the time on the ship, the way I see it.
1. We leave on Sat. 3/10/07 - early Sunday Moring we will have to "spring ahead" 1 hour.
2. Then when we leave Key West and head for Grand Cayman we will have to "fall back" 1 hour since we will then be in the Central time zone.
3. After leaving Cozumel, we will once again have to "spring ahead" 1 hour as we enter the eastern time zone again heading towards Castaway Cay.

However, I could be wrong!

They will make announcements on the ship as to what you should do to your watch/clock and at what times. It won't be a problem.
